Estee Lauder has some really fair colors in their extended wear. More affordable options are the Maybelline fit me has some really pale options as well. I struggled with this for a long time until companies realized that there were more than seven skin tones out there. Good luck!

L’Oréal true matte foundation is an oldie but goodie, great shade range and affordable. Im also very pale almost blue in colouring and I normally go between N.05 and C.05 but anyone looking for affordable shades for deep skin also worth checking out! Stocked in most drugstores so should be able to swatch before you buy!
